Further Questions from South African Growers
Which medium suits it best? Depends what you are optimising for. Organic soil cut with 30% perlite and amended with bone meal, rock phosphate and kelp meal gives the fuller flavour, and all three are stocked by garden centres, agricultural co-ops and hydro shops countrywide. Coco under automated fertigation at EC 1.4-1.8 through bloom gives the bigger number. This indica genetics performs in either.
Does it cope with real summer heat? Reasonably. The dense foliage shades itself, so a spell above 28°C slows growth without stalling it. Mulch the root zone and water before 7am and heat stress stays manageable through most of the country.
When do I switch to bloom feed? As soon as pistils show, not a fortnight later. The 83/17 genetics changes its demand sharply at the transition: phosphorus and potassium uptake rises while nitrogen demand falls away. Soil growers can top-dress with guano and sulphate of potash; coco and hydro growers should move to a low-N, high-PK formula immediately.
